Plans for the development of the microelectronic industry: 300 design centers by 2030, 6 thousand specialists by 2024 - a representative of the military-industrial complex
The share of foreign electronics in public procurement in 2020 decreased from 51% to 43%, and should decrease even more due to the government decree on the minimum share of purchases of goods of Russian origin, which entered into force on January 1, 2021, a member of the board of the Military-Industrial Commission (MIC) said at the plenary session "Electronic industry as a technological basis for sovereign and innovative development" of the first International Industrial Forum "Intelligence of Machines and Mechanisms", held in Sevastopol.

The Ministry of Defense will create a department for working with artificial intelligence by December 1
The Office will have its own budget
The Ministry of Defense will form an office for working with artificial intelligence with its own budget by December 2021. This was announced on Monday by Mikhail Osyko, a member of the Military-Industrial Commission under the Government of the Russian Federation.
